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Inverness, Scotland and Dunnet Head, Scotland?

Stagecoach North Scotland operates a bus from Bus Station Stance 3 to Ross Cottage 5 times a day.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 3h 22m. Alternatively, ScotRail operates a train from Inverness to Thurso 3 times a day. Tickets cost £65–130 and the journey takes 3h 49m.
